Biondi A, Scialfa G
J Neuroradiol. 1988;15(3):253-65.
The authors report MR findings in 139 patients with 159 cerebral vascular malformations (36 arteriovenous malformations, 25 venous angiomas and 98 cavernous angiomas). Morphological aspects and hemodynamic findings due to rapid and slow flow are analysed. MR is able to differentiate the various type of lesions and permits the visualization of angiographically occult vascular malformations. In the case of cavernous angiomas MR information may not be sufficient for an absolute diagnosis because of differential diagnostic problems; correlation with the clinical history, CT and angiographic findings and follow-up MR study are certain to be necessary to increase specificity. Usually it is possible to distinguish histopathological components of the lesion and perilesional modifications in the cerebral parenchyma.
